Pension Question

Hi

My income for ITY 2014/5 will be made up of earned income, cashing a small (under £10k) pension plan and a single payment from a capped drawdown.

Can I pay a contribution to another pension plan in respect of earned income or would it be deemed to be recycling of contributions?

    it would be recycling if you used the TFLS, not income. You are free to put your earned income into a pension (assuming the rules dont change).

    Recycling isn't banned, there are just limits within which is is permitted and beyond which the recycled portion above that is treated as an unauthorised payment. Not much chance of what you want to do falling into the restrictions of the rule but you should check to be sure. One easy rule is that lump sum recycling up to 1% of the lifetime allowance (£12,500 for a £1.25 million allowance) is fine. If you happen to go over that one there are a range of other conditions that also have to be met before it would be unauthorised recycling.

    Recycling income is permitted regardless so if the money from the capped drawdown is income within the GAD limit that portion would be fine.
